1-22. ELECTRICAL SYSTEMS OPERATION (Contd)
b. Starting System Operation.
The starting system is identical for all models covered in this manual and consists of the following major
components and circuitry:
Key Item and Function
8  BATTERY SWITCH - Completes circuit 459, closing a relay in the protective control box to supply
power to ignition switch through circuits 5 and 5B.
9  PROTECTIVE CONTROL BOX - Locks out starter circuit, which prevents starter from reengaging
while engine is running.
1 0  IGNITION SWITCH - Provides battery power to fuel solenoid through circuit 54 and the neutral
start safety switch through circuit 498.
11  NEUTRAL START SAFETY SWITCH - Prevents starter from energizing when vehicle is not in
neutral, by deenergizing circuit 499 and a relay in the protective control box, which disconnects
power from circuit 74 and the starter solenoid.
12  STARTER SOLENOID - A magnetic relay that is powered by circuit 74 to transmit 24-volt battery
power to the starter motor through circuit 6.
13  STARTER MOTOR - Cranks engine for starting. Supplied with 24-volt battery power through
circuit 6.
